#' @title A Disequilibrium Model Illustrating Insufficient Effective Demand (Supply-demand Structural Mismatch)
#' @aliases demInsufficientEffectiveDemand_3_3
#' @description  A disequilibrium model illustrating supply-demand structural mismatch and insufficient effective demand.
#' Assume that from the 5th period, the producer expects the sales rate of products to decline,
#' so he reduces investment in production and increases the demand for value storage means (such as foreign assets, gold, etc.);
#' the laborer expects the unemployment rate to rise, so he reduces consumption and increases the demand for value storage means.
#'
#' Here the supplier of value storage means is referred to as ROW (the rest of the world).
